Ten Killed in Graz High School Shooting, Shooter Found Dead

  • A gunman attacked the Dreierschützengasse high school in Graz, Austria, on June 10, 2025, killing nine people before taking his own life.
  • Authorities reported the 21-year-old shooter was a former student who did not complete his studies and used two legally owned weapons.
  • First responders secured the school area, evacuated students and staff by 11:30 a.m., and transported several injured to local hospitals.
  • Austrian Chancellor Christian Stocker described the shooting as a profound tragedy affecting the entire nation, while officials confirmed that there is no ongoing threat.
  • The attack prompted national mourning and highlighted concerns about gun ownership and school safety in Graz, Austria's second-largest city with 300,000 residents.
